Overview: During the latest Tarpon Springs Heritage Preservation Board meeting, the board approved the installation of awnings on a historic property on Hibiscus Street. The decision included a restrictive covenant to ensure future compliance with historic preservation standards. The meeting also covered the potential impact of the state’s Elevate Florida program on local historic neighborhoods, particularly regarding flood damage mitigation.

Overview: The St. Pete Beach City Commission meeting on January 29, 2025, was marked by discussion over a variance request from the St. Pete Beach Yacht and Tennis Club for new storage sheds, following destruction from Hurricane Milton. The request, which involves replacing existing sheds with larger ones that exceed zoning regulations, sparked community concern over aesthetic impacts on nearby properties. The commission ultimately postponed a decision to allow more time for community negotiations and exploration of alternative solutions.

Overview: The Barrier Islands Governmental Council meeting on January 29 focused on issues surrounding sand renourishment projects, infrastructure repairs due to storm damage, and the challenges of federal bureaucracy in securing necessary easements and permits. The council engaged in discussions on the impending deadlines and obstacles hindering progress in their coastal protection initiatives.
